## Canary Gating at Lumenfold

Our deploy pipeline for the Driftway service promotes builds through canary stages automatically. A canary advances only when error rate stays under 0.5% and p95 latency under 300ms for 20 minutes. If either threshold trips, the gate rolls back and pages the on-call rotation. Gate decisions are made by the Sentrigate evaluator, which needs access to the metrics API in staging and production. Before running the evaluator locally, add the following line to your .env file:

sealed setting: ARCHIVE_KEY3=8d0

### Step 4: Cut Over the User Module

Once the Harkwell monolith stops writing to `users_legacy`, enable dual-read mode in the new Identity service and verify checksum parity for 24 hours. Freeze schema changes during this window. After parity holds, flip the router flag and decommission the legacy writer. Point the Identity service at the dedicated user store via the connection string below.

warehouse DSN: clickhouse://druys_svc:Pl@db-47e1.orvexstack.corp:5432/beldor

Subject: Receipt mailer cut-over complete

Hi all — the Givlet receipt mailer moved to the new delivery pipeline last night. Plugins that hook the receipt-rendered event need no changes; the payload shape is unchanged. Retry behavior is now centralized, so drop any custom backoff logic. The mailer now runs with the configuration shown below.

config for kagup-hahig:
druwyn:
  pin: 2801
  metrics_host: metrics.druwyn.zemvarlabs.internal
  tenant: sorius
  seal: seal_798a43d7